[Buildroot] [PATCH 3/4] libfslparser: add install hooks to fix libraries path

Gary Bisson gary.bisson at boundarydevices.com
Sun Nov 8 16:08:43 UTC 2015


Hi Jérôme,

On Fri, Oct 30, 2015 at 11:43 AM, Jérôme Pouiller <jezz at sysmic.org> wrote:
> On Friday 30 October 2015 11:36:21 Gary Bisson wrote:
>> Hi Jerome,
>>
>> On Fri, Oct 30, 2015 at 11:27 AM, Jérôme Pouiller <jezz at sysmic.org>
> wrote:
> [...]
>> > A POST_INSTALL_STAGING_HOOKS is not necessary for libfslparser?
>>
>> No, libfslparser is only needed by gst-fsl-plugins which looks for the
>> libs at the right location at build time (usr/lib/imx-mm).
>>
>> The staging hook is needed for libfslcodec since it is used by both
>> gst-fsl-plugins and gst1-imx (not looking at the imx-mm path at build
>> time).
>>
>> Although it might have been more consistent to have the staging hook
>> in both, I chose to reduce the patch as much as possible. Plus I'm not
>> sure people will like my symlink approach in the staging directory.
> IMHO, target/ should be a subset of staging/ (even if today, this is far
> from  the case). So, I would prefer to also create symlinks in staging/.

So I'm ok with adding the symlinks to the fslparser staging as well.
But if we'd really like to have target as a subset of staging,
shouldn't we use symlinks for the target too?

Regards,
Gary


More information about the buildroot mailing list